Get in Touch** The BMW repair market serving Soulsbyville is concentrated in the nearby city of Sonora, approximately a 10-15 minute drive away. As a rural and mountainous region, there is a notable demand for competent xDrive system servicing. The market is characterized by a small number of high-quality, independent specialists who have built strong local reputations over many years, effectively competing with the nearest dealerships which are located in Modesto, over an hour away. The competition level is moderate but specialized, with these top-tier shops often having waiting lists due to high demand for their expertise. Typical pricing is below dealership rates but reflects the high level of specialized skill and advanced diagnostic equipment required, with general maintenance starting around $150-$200 per hour and specialized diagnostics or performance work commanding a premium.

Common questions about bmw repair services in Soulsbyville, CA
Given the Sierra Nevada foothills terrain, we frequently address suspension component wear, brake system service due to mountain driving, and cooling system issues exacerbated by summer heat. Older BMW models also commonly require attention for oil leaks from valve cover gaskets and oil filter housings.
Look for shops in Soulsbyville or nearby Sonora that are certified by the Automotive Service Excellence (ASE) program and specifically advertise BMW or European car expertise. Checking for membership in the BMW Car Club of America (CCA) and reading local reviews about diagnostic accuracy are excellent indicators of a quality specialist.
Typically, yes, independent specialists in the Soulsbyville/Tuolumne County area offer significant savings on labor rates compared to dealerships in the Central Valley, while using the same quality OEM or OEM-equivalent parts. However, pricing can vary, so it's wise to get a detailed written estimate for any major service.
